Jerusalem University College (EIN: 36-2392710)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2024 IRS Form 990 filing, Jerusalem University College,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 2 out of 28 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$165,145. The highest compensated employee at Jerusalem University College is Oliver Hersey with fiscal year 2024 compensation of $207,287.

Mission Statement
Jerusalem University College creates opportunities for students to deepen their knowledge of God and His Word through immersive study of the ancient and modern contexts of Israel and the surrounding regions, equipping them for academia, ministry, and global service.
